DevOps BootCamp/데이터베이스

SQL - INSERT, UPDATE, DELETE

cloudmaster 2023. 3. 29. 10:26

INSERT INTO 구문

INSERT INTO table_name (column1, column2, column3, ...)
VALUES (value1, value2, value3, ...);

 

INSERT INTO table_name
VALUES (value1, value2, value3, ...);

 > 모든 열에 값을 추가하는 경우, 속성 추가 x

 

지정된 열에만 데이터 삽입

INSERT INTO Customers (CustomerName, City, Country)
VALUES ('Cardinal', 'Stavanger', 'Norway');

 

★ NULL : NULL 값이 있는 필드는 값이 없는 필드

 

IS NULL 구문

SELECT column_names
FROM table_name
WHERE column_name IS NULL;

IS NOT NULL 구문

SELECT column_names
FROM table_name
WHERE column_name IS NOT NULL;
 
 

● 업데이트 구문

UPDATE table_name
SET column1 = value1, column2 = value2, ...
WHERE condition;

 

● SQL DELETE 문

 > DELETE명령문은 테이블의 기존 레코드를 삭제하는 데 사용

 

DELETE FROM table_name WHERE condition;

 

 

 

'DevOps BootCamp > 데이터베이스' 카테고리의 다른 글

파티셔닝  (0) 2023.03.29
레플리카  (0) 2023.03.29
낮은 검색 성능 - 인덱싱  (0) 2023.03.29
SQL - SELECT  (0) 2023.03.29
데이터베이스 기초  (0) 2023.03.29